Ahead of this summer's launch, PlayStation gives us another look at Activision and Beenox's much-anticipated Crash Bandicoot racing game, Crash Team Racing Nitro-Fueled. PS4 players can look forward to a bevy of exclusive retro content, including retro skins for Crash, Coco and Cortex, as well as retro karts and a retro track.

Crash Team Racing Nitro-Fueled will also feature tracks, karts, arenas and battle modes from Crash Nitro Kart, which is the sequel to Crash Team Racing from 1999. Crash Nitro Kart debuted in 2003 for PlayStation 2, GameCube, Xbox and Game Boy Advance.

Crash Team Racing Nitro-Fueled was announced at last year's The Game Awards. The title is due out on PlayStation 4, Xbox One and Nintendo Switch on June 21.
